SUTE OF MINNESOTA
COUNTY OF RAMSEY
VILLAGE OF ARDEN HILLS
SANImy SEWER IMPROVEMENT NO. 5
RESOLUTION ORDERING THE I1IBTALIATION OF THE
SANITARY SEWER S"YSTEM TO BE KNOWN AS SAlI1ITARY
SEWER IMPROVEMENT NO. 5~ AND ACCEPTING BID THEREON
WHEREAS~ a Resolution of the Village Council adopted the 30th day of
October~ 1961~ fixed a date for a Counoil hearing : on the 27th day of
November~ 1961~ at 8100 o'olock P. M. in tha Village Hall, for a publio
hearing on the advisability of instalJ1ng.ng a ,smitary sewr system in the
. area in the Village of Arden Hills located generally on the Northeasterly
intersection of HAm11ne Avenue and County Road E~ and described as follows~
to-wit:
That portion of swi of SEi of Section 27, Township 30,
Range 23~ lying southerly of Minneapolis~ St. Paul and
Sault Ste. Marie Railway Company's right of way~ all
in the Village of Arden Hills, Ramsey County, MiImesota~ and
WEEREAS~ said Resolution was based upon plans and epecif'ieations for
said Sanitary Sewer Installation prepared by the Villaga Enginser and approved
by the Council, which plans and specifications indicated that the oonstl'llct-
ion would involve the installation of approximately 1,050 lineal feet of
sanitary sewer varying in size from 8 inch to 12 inoh~ together with
apP11rtenances~ and
WHEREAS~ ten days' publiShed notice of the hearing through two weakly
publioli4tions of the notice was duly given and the hearing was )1eld thereon
. on the 27th day of Ma.rch~ 1961~ at whioh time all persons desiring to be
heard were given an opportunity to be heard thereon, and
WHERE:AS, John Rysgaard and Oscar Husby, representing Husby Properties~
Inc., were present at said hearing and stated that they, representing two
of the property owners involved~ favored said improvement. The Counoil was
further advised by Mr. Husby that Walter Stepnitz~ a third property owner
involved~ was also in favor of the improvement. There were no statements
in oppoaition to the improvement~ and
- 1 ..
. ..
. .
.
. .
. WHEREAS, ptll'Suant to an Advertisement for Bids, for the a:foresaid
projedt in accordance with the Council ResolutioJ1Pl;ssed October 30, 1961,
bids for said project were received, opened and tabulated according to law
at the Council Meeting on. November 27, 1961, and nine bids were received
in compliance with the Advertisement, which bids were received, opened and
tabulated according to law, and a tabulation of said bids prepared by the
Village Engineer is atteched hereto and incorporated herein, and
WHERI!:AS, it appears that the bid of Peter Lametti Construction Co. in
the amount of Seven Thousand Six Hundred and Twenty Four Dollars ($7,624.00),
is the lowest and best bid submitted,
NOW HRE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CJL OF WE V!IJ.AGE OF A1lDEN ,
MINNESOTA, AS FOIJ:.a.1S. TO-WIT:
(1) The aforesaid improvement is hereby ordered as proposed in the
. Council Resolution adopted Ootober 30, 1961, in aocordanea with the plans
and specifications as submitted by the Village Engineer on said dste.
(2) Said improvement shall be made in accordance with the a:foresaid
plans and specifications submitted by Banister Engineering Co, Village
Engineers, and approved by this Council on Ootober 3D, 1961. Banister Engin-
eering Co. ars hereby designated as the engineers for this improvement.
(3) The Mayor and Clerk ars hereby authorized and directed to enter
:Into the proposed contract with Peter La.matti Construction Company in the
nama of the Village of Arden Hills for the improvement as hereinbefore des-
cribed, all in accordance with the plans and specifications heretofore
approved by the Village Council and filed with the Village Clerk.
(4) The Village Clerk is hereby authorized and directed to return forth
with to all bidders deposits made with their bids, except that the deposit of
. the successful bidder and the next lowest bidder shall be retained until a
contract has been signed.
Adopted by the Village Council this27th day of November, 1961.
